视觉SLAM 14讲中cere拟合曲线代码报错:

/usr/bin/x86_64-linux-gnu-ld: /usr/local/lib/libceres.a(coordinate_descent_minimizer.cc.o): undefined reference to symbol 'omp_get_num_threads@@OMP_1.0'
//usr/lib/x86_64-linux-gnu/libgomp.so.1: 无法添加符号: DSO missing from command line
collect2: error: ld returned 1 exit status
CMakeFiles/curve_fitting.dir/build.make:134: recipe for target 'curve_fitting' failed
make[2]: *** [curve_fitting] Error 1
CMakeFiles/Makefile2:67: recipe for target 'CMakeFiles/curve_fitting.dir/all' failed
make[1]: *** [CMakeFiles/curve_fitting.dir/all] Error 2
Makefile:83: recipe for target 'all' failed
make: *** [all] Error 2

解决方法:

在CMakeList中添加:

FIND_PACKAGE( OpenMP REQUIRED)
if(OPENMP_FOUND)message("OPENMP FOUND")set(CMAKE_C_FLAGS "${CMAKE_C_FLAGS} ${OpenMP_C_FLAGS}")set(CMAKE_CXX_FLAGS "${CMAKE_CXX_FLAGS} ${OpenMP_CXX_FLAGS}")
endif()

SLAM 14讲中cere拟合曲线代码报错:undefined reference to symbol ‘omp_get_num_threads@@OMP_1.0‘相关推荐

  1. 记录一个CMake编译报错undefined reference to vtable问题的解决

    在编写一个简单的CMake demo: 问题描述 文件结构如下:头文件和cpp分别放在两个文件夹下面 如果使用下面的写法,会报错"undefined reference to vtable ...

  2. 解决交叉编译连接器包含-ldl编译选项,但仍然报错undefined reference to ‘__dlsym‘

    交叉编译连接器包含-ldl编译选项,但仍然报错undefined reference to '__dlsym' 文章目录 交叉编译连接器包含-ldl编译选项,但仍然报错undefined refere ...

  3. linux使用gcc编译报错“undefined reference to `pthread_create'”

    下面这个例子通过一个代码说明两个线程关联一个函数,实现并发操作,预期结果这两个线程都使用了print函数,它们各自执行各自的,不会因为使用了同一个函数而受到影响. my_test.cpp #inclu ...

  4. SLAM十四讲ch7代码调整(undefined reference to symbol)

    SLAM十四讲ch7代码调整--2021.6.14 1.首先大部分的代码需要在Cmakelists中更新至c++14,否则会出现如下报错 /usr/local/include/g2o/core/bas ...

  5. golang 同一个包中函数互相调用报错 undefined 以及在 VSCode 中配置右键执行整个包文件

    1. 代码结构 demo 文件夹下有两个文件,分别为 hello.go 和 main.go ,结构如下: wohu@wohu:~/GoCode/src$ tree demo/ demo/ ├── he ...

  6. matlab使用mex编译c语言报错undefined reference to `__imp_WSAStartup‘

    matlab中使用mex编译c语言文件报错提示: undefined reference to __imp_WSAStartup' 最近我在做一个simulink和其他仿真软件的联合仿真,需要用到ud ...

  7. Clion使用Socket报错undefined reference to `__imp_WSAStartup‘(解决办法)

    根据哔哩哔哩上的视频,使用Clion写一个Socket的服务器,但是当写完之后发现并不能运行,程序报错. ====================[ 构建 | MyHttpd | Debug ]=== ...

  8. 编译报错: undefined reference to `pcl::console::print(pcl::console::VERBOSITY_LEVEL, char const*, ...)‘

    写在前面 自己在写一个调用 pcl 的程序,编译的时候遇到如下问题: In function `void pcl::detail::FieldMapper<pcl::PointXYZ>:: ...

  9. amd64上编译pcl报错undefined reference to `png_init_filter_functions_neon‘

    vtk编译没问题,但pcl报错,这是因为arm架构下与pcl编译相关的部分vtk库编译有所偏差,把vtk下thirdparty/png/vtkpng/png private.h的第128到133行注释 ...

最新文章

  1. PXE部署映像(WinPE 2.0)
  2. NODEJS项目实践0.4 [domain,pm2,log4js,md5]
  3. docker-3-常用命令(上)
  4. 每日一皮:我觉得明明很好用啊,谁知道客户是这样用的呢?
  5. 【原创】C# API 未能创建 SSL/TLS 安全通道 问题解决
  6. JavaScript Repeater 模板控件
  7. ES6减少魔法操作之Reflect
  8. 【保存】java学习全套视频下载地址
  9. Unity shader入门之数据类型
  10. 近24小时以太坊上的DEX交易量超过150亿美元
  11. 用c语言编写linux守护进程
  12. FFA 2021 专场解读 - 生产实践 / 机器学习
  13. 线程并行化的概念及其用法
  14. 黑白风格android,颜色风格略不同 黑白华为Mate对比图赏
  15. 0门槛项目,闲鱼卖特价电影票,免费低价票源
  16. 2020-09-07(基于控制台的DVD管理系统)
  17. 【员工端】OA办公系统移动端高保真Axure原型模板
  18. python打印菱形三种方法_用python打印菱形的实操方法和代码
  19. Initramfs unpacking failed:junk in compressed archive
  20. 在线播放ppt html5,强大的HTML5幻灯片系统:H5Slides

热门文章

  1. JavaScript实现堆结构
  2. GAT1400注册和保活及上下级关系
  3. 超全!2020互联网大厂的薪资和职级一览
  4. Node服务器 - koa框架
  5. 如何在Python中创建Excel表格
  6. 非靜態初始化塊與夠着函數的 執行順序
  7. [记录]英国][记录/历史/战争][第一次世界大战全记录(全10集)][DVD-AVI/7.27G][英语外挂中英双字
  8. 【R语言实验】主成分分析
  9. 前端CSS基础之案例--图片
  10. 9-19作业-宋俊杰